End Mill Selection: Materials, Coatings, and Geometry
Choosing the correct end cutter involves careful consideration of multiple factors: material grade, coating layer , and shape . Different materials, such as fast steel, cobalt , and full tungsten , offer different levels of strength and erosion resistance. Coatings – including TiAlN , CrAl nitride, and amorphous carbon – provide enhanced outside finish, minimized friction, and boosted machining life . In conclusion, the tip geometry—including groove count, spiral , and lead angle—significantly impacts chip removal and finished quality.

Improving Milling Operations with the Correct Tool Holder
Selecting the ideal fixture is essential for improving machining processes and gaining excellent precision. A poorly tool holder can lead to chatter, reduced longevity, and affected part accuracy. Evaluate factors such as machine rigidity, taper type (e.g. CAT), holding forces, and the cutting tool being employed. Moreover, employing a vibration-dampened tool holder can considerably lessen chatter and improve overall output.
- Opt for a tool holder compatible with your machine spindle.
- Frequently check tool holders for cracks.
- Evaluate using a precision fixture for demanding cutting.
